The Movements of the Planets
The Moon moves around the Earth every 27.32 days, while the Sun’s return is celebrated every year as a birthday. Mercury and Venus also land back at their starting-place roughly once a year, while Mars takes almost two years to get there. Jupiter takes about a year to work its way through each sign of the zodiac, and therefore returns to its natal position roughly every 12 years. Saturn makes its return approximately every 29.5 years. Uranus has an 84-year orbit and therefore makes a half- return after roughly 42 years, while Neptune, with its 165-year orbit, makes a half-return when the subject is around the age of 82. Pluto moves too slowly and in too eccentric an orbit to lay down any hard and fast rules about its aspects. The angles that a planet can make to its own natal position, or that any planet can make to any other, or to the ascendant or any other feature on a chart, are known as aspects. The major aspects are the conjunction, sextile, square, trine and opposition. For technical reasons which I won’t go into here, all these planets occasionally have slight variations in their orbits. Because the Earth and all the other planets orbit the Sun, there are times when we appear to be overtaking them. This apparent backwards motion of the planets is called retrograde motion. The Sun and the Moon never ‘go retrograde’.
The Planetary Cycles
Just for your information or for future reference, here are the planetary orbits in list form:
The Earth orbits the Sun in approximately 365.25 days (one year).
The Moon orbits the Earth in 27.32 days. Mercury orbits the Sun in 88 days. Venus orbits the Sun in 225 days.
Mars orbits the Sun in 1 year, 10.5 months.
Jupiter orbits the Sun in 12 years. Saturn orbits the Sun in 29 years. Uranus orbits the Sun in 84 years. Neptune orbits the Sun in 165 years. Pluto orbits the Sun in 246 years.
